Home / Function/ Test_App_Prefork_Child_Process_Never_Show_Startup_Message() — fiber Function Reference

Test_App_Prefork_Child_Process_Never_Show_Startup_Message() — fiber Function Reference

Architecture documentation for the Test_App_Prefork_Child_Process_Never_Show_Startup_Message() function in prefork_test.go from the fiber codebase.

Entity Profile

Dependency Diagram

graph TD
  8d580732_74f5_a1ac_2242_2a200796139d["Test_App_Prefork_Child_Process_Never_Show_Startup_Message()"]
  6fe215fa_3f3d_4def_0d1c_6cf140e007c0["prefork_test.go"]
  8d580732_74f5_a1ac_2242_2a200796139d -->|defined in| 6fe215fa_3f3d_4def_0d1c_6cf140e007c0
  831a5231_66c7_9c6b_986a_d20e2a7c1b11["setupIsChild()"]
  8d580732_74f5_a1ac_2242_2a200796139d -->|calls| 831a5231_66c7_9c6b_986a_d20e2a7c1b11
  style 8d580732_74f5_a1ac_2242_2a200796139d fill:#6366f1,stroke:#818cf8,color:#fff

Relationship Graph

Source Code

prefork_test.go lines 78–100

func Test_App_Prefork_Child_Process_Never_Show_Startup_Message(t *testing.T) {
	setupIsChild(t)

	rescueStdout := os.Stdout
	defer func() { os.Stdout = rescueStdout }()

	r, w, err := os.Pipe()
	require.NoError(t, err)

	os.Stdout = w

	cfg := listenConfigDefault()
	app := New()
	app.startupProcess()
	listenData := app.prepareListenData(":0", false, &cfg, nil)
	app.startupMessage(listenData, &cfg)

	require.NoError(t, w.Close())

	out, err := io.ReadAll(r)
	require.NoError(t, err)
	require.Empty(t, out)
}

Domain

Subdomains

Defined In

Frequently Asked Questions

What does Test_App_Prefork_Child_Process_Never_Show_Startup_Message() do?
Test_App_Prefork_Child_Process_Never_Show_Startup_Message() is a function in the fiber codebase, defined in prefork_test.go.
Where is Test_App_Prefork_Child_Process_Never_Show_Startup_Message() defined?
Test_App_Prefork_Child_Process_Never_Show_Startup_Message() is defined in prefork_test.go at line 78.
What does Test_App_Prefork_Child_Process_Never_Show_Startup_Message() call?
Test_App_Prefork_Child_Process_Never_Show_Startup_Message() calls 1 function(s): setupIsChild.

Analyze Your Own Codebase

Get architecture documentation, dependency graphs, and domain analysis for your codebase in minutes.

Try Supermodel Free